- The distance between Multan, Pakistan and Wallaceville, New Zealand is approximately 13,227 km or 8,220 mi.
- To reach Multan in this distance one would set out from Wallaceville bearing 286.3°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Multan bearing 303.2° or WNW .
- Multan has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Wallaceville has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Multan is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Wallaceville is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 12.9 °C (23.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.3 °C (23.9°F) more in Multan.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1111.4 mm (43.8 in) less which is equivalent to 1111.4 l/m² (27.28 US gal/ft²) or 11,114,000 l/ha (1,188,160 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.6° higher in Multan than in Wallaceville.
